Our mortgage calculator is a quick and easy way to help you work out how much you could borrow. The actual amount you could borrow will depend on a number of factors, including the amount of deposit you have, any outstanding credit commitments and your monthly outgoing.
The calculation shows how much lenders could let you borrow based on your income. The amount shown is an estimate based on a multiple of your sole or joint income. You need to go directly to a lender to find the exact amount they can lend you.
– In the past, mortgage lenders based the amount you could borrow mainly on a multiple of your income. This is known as the loan-to-income ratio. For example, if your annual income was 50,000, you might have been able to borrow three to five times this amount, giving you a mortgage of up to 250,000.

"How much can I borrow for a mortgage loan based on my income?" This is one of the most common questions we received from our readers. The answer to this question has more to do with your debt-to-income ratio and your ability to repay the debt, rather than the loan limits featured on our website.
